0

私は (ローカル) 開発者向けのポータルを開発しており、PHPEd でブラウザーから直接 PHP ファイルを開くことができるようにしたいと考えています。

私は2つの解決策を見つけましたが、それらを機能させることができませんでした:

  • 解決策 1: 新しいプロトコル (phped_protocol) を作成し、" phped_protocol://[file]" を URI として使用する
  • 解決策 2: PHPEd を開くバッチ スクリプトを実行する

誰かがこれらの解決策の 1 つを手伝ってくれませんか? PHP/ブラウザ経由で、PHPEd を使用して PHP ファイルを開く方法を知りたいです。

== 編集 ==

解決策 1

test.reg

REGEDIT4

[HKEY_CLASSES_ROOT\phped_protocol] 
@="URL:phpedProtocol" 
"URL Protocol"="" 

[HKEY_CLASSES_ROOT\phped_protocol\shell] 

[HKEY_CLASSES_ROOT\phped_protocol\shell\open] 

[HKEY_CLASSES_ROOT\phped_protocol\shell\open\command] 
@="\"C:\\phped_protocol.bat\" \"%1\""

test.html

<a href="phped_protocol://[file]">Open file</a>

解決策 2

phped_protocol.bat

START "test" "C:\Program Files (x86)\NuSphere\PhpED\7.0\phped.exe"
EXIT

test.php

system('CMD /C C:\phped_protocol.bat');
4

1 に答える 1

0

現在のソリューションは、リスナーとデータベースです。PHP はデータベースにレコードを挿入します。リスナーがそれを見つけると、ファイルが開きます。

于 2012-08-01T16:35:23.123 に答える